Eureka, ILL. -- Principia volleyball began their road trip with a 3-1 victory over the Eureka Red Devils. The 3-1 score most certainly does not tell the story! The Panthers were dominant in game one, mostly due to the fact that Eureka's offense couldn't find the court. They kept swinging, but too many errors for them to have a chance - letting Principia run away with it 25-13. Game two seemed to be more of the same with PC up 18-9, but Eureka woke up and started their comeback. The Panthers stuttered on serve receive, miscommunicated on defense, hit a few too many out, and EC was doing a nice job blocking the ball! It was a fight until the end, but EC took game two 29-27. Game three was the inverse with PC going down 4-10 and things weren't getting any better so Coach Sprague called a timeout at 13-18, and the team bounced back into action erasing the deficit slowly and tying it up 22-22 and eventually winning game three 27-25. Game four had Principia down 0-3, but the Panthers kept at it until they tied it at 9-9 and then took total control for a 25-18 win.
Inside the Box Score
· PC outserved EC with a 13:6 aces to error compared with EC's 6:9.
· Cha Cha Fisher and Devon Marunde led the defense with 21 and 20 digs respectively.
· Sophia Hathaway led both teams offensively with 18 kills hitting .292.
